The VKB Group is an agricultural company, providing support to farmers and producing straight-from-the farm-foods for consumers. Our roots are in agriculture with farming at our core, continuously growing and evolving. VKB Milling (Pty) Ltd operates white maize mills in Mokopane and Louis Trichardt in Limpopo, a wheat mill in Frankfort in the Free State, and additional mills in Christiana and Modderrivier in the Northern Cape.

VKB Milling is part of VKB Agri Processors (Pty) Ltd, the agri-processing division of the VKB Group. The VKB Group is a significant player in the South African agricultural industry, committed to best practices, continuous improvement, and world-class operations to add value to the industry.
